Get startedWhite Cross Court is a one-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Newton Le Willows (WA12 0DT). It has a recorded floor area of 40 m² (around 431 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(June 2015)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since March 2011.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from June 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. At 40 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 32 units on EPC record in White Cross Court, where floor areas span 38–85 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B across 32 units on file.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 1.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£111,000 sits 85% above the 2017 sale of £60,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£139/sq ft) was about 26.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 40 m² it sits well below the postcode median (62 m² across 31 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. 9 years since the last transfer (February 2017).
